While I don't see why it shouldn't skippable for those that want it to be, I don't take the song as being about religion in this context. Yes, it has religious ties but Mother Giselle sings it to muster hope in a dark moment. It can be taken as a song about faith but not nessecary about having faith in the Maker but about having faith in you, in that the dawn will come and that this dark moment will pass.
It's done by soldiers, refugees and in many dire times because it is a good and easy way to motivate people, to unify and bring them together by lifting their spirits.
... or so I understood it.
